Setting up and managing roles, users, and permissions in Postgres might sound easy until you need to implement fine-grained access control for different users and groups of people, apps, or endpoints. pg_acm (Postgres Access Control Management) is a new set of tools that simplifies configuring and managing roles and privileges. The key feature of this framework is that each schema is created with a predefined set of roles and default privileges. This makes it easy to achieve full isolation between different projects sharing the same database and allows authorized users to manage access to their own data without superuser privileges.
